2011-02-08 59 views
3

我正在生成消息傳遞系統並考慮使用ActiveMQ with XMPP作爲傳輸方式。我已經使用普通的XMPP和OpenFire服務器來實現系統分佈式部件之間基於類似消息傳遞的通信。鑑於Apache ActiveMQ中內置的Jabber服務器與Openfire Jabber服務器一樣靈活且可擴展,因此在XMPP之上分層ActiveMQ的優勢是什麼。在純XMPP上使用Apache ActiveMQ + XMPP進行消息傳遞

問題1)我可以使用Openfire替換內置的Jabber服務器並仍然使用ActiveMQ嗎?

所有客戶端和服務器組件都將使用Java,並且過去我使用了Openfire Xmpp(Spark)庫。

問題2)什麼會的ActiveMQ的經紀XMPP

回答

0

ActiveMQ的吸引力下降了XMPP的支持幾個版本前,所以你可能不會發現任何優勢,以這種方式使用它。 XMPP支持並沒有很好地實施,從來沒有得到很多的使用。